Wedbush Issues Pessimistic Estimate for Tesla Earnings

Tesla, Inc. (NASDAQ:TSLAFree Report) – Wedbush reduced their Q4 2026 earnings estimates for Tesla in a research report issued to clients and investors on Wednesday, April 23rd. Wedbush analyst D. Ives now expects that the electric vehicle producer will earn $0.70 per share for the quarter, down from their previous forecast of $0.86. Wedbush has a “Outperform” rating and a $350.00 price target on the stock. The consensus estimate for Tesla’s current full-year earnings is $2.56 per share.

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LAG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, April 22nd. The electric vehicle producer reported $0.27 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.53 by ($0.26). Tesla had a net margin of 7.26% and a return on equity of 10.31%. The business had revenue of $19.34 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$22.93 billion.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.45 EPS.

About Tesla

(Get Free Report)

Tesla, Inc designs, develops, manufactures, leases, and sells electric vehicles, and energy generation and storage systems in the United States, China, and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Automotive, and Energy Generation and Storage. The Automotive segment offers electric vehicles, as well as sells automotive regulatory credits; and non-warranty after-sales vehicle, used vehicles, body shop and parts, supercharging, retail merchandise, and vehicle insurance services.
